Re: Loctite BlackMax to hold front sight???
Joe,
Here is the scoop on loctite Black Max 380:
Elastomer modified instant adhesive
gap fill= .006
tensile shear strength= 3,750
temperature range-65 degrees F to 225 degrees F
cure speed, fixture; 90 seconds; full 24 hours
I think it will do what you want it to.
